Listening to your video, sounds like it is the same frequency as the engine. I would check the exhaust from the engine to the tail pipe. Shake the tail pipe and see if you can hear the noise. The exhaust pipe hangs from rubber isolators, and sometime they can get tweaked and cause the tail pipe to hang incorrectly and vibrate against something it shouldn't. I'd start there, sounds to me like it is coming from under the car.
